Application Area
The sheet extruder is composed of extrusion, calendaring, traction and rolling. The main parts are abrasion resistant, resistant to corrosion, and high-temperature resistant by high quality specially-treated. Low resistance force in die head extruding channel makes sheet thickness evenly, the internal spiral tank in three rollers ensures an effective cooling. The machine extrudes PP/PS granule to PP/PS sheet with single color, which is used for producing plastic products by plastic thermoforming machines, like cups, food containers, trays, dishes, bowls, lids, etc.
Technical Highlights
1. Screw and Barrel: Made of 38CrMoAlA with nitriding treatment for superior hardness, corrosion resistance, and long service life.
2. T-die Design: Cloth-hanger style design enables molten material to flow evenly from the outlet for consistent quality.
3. Filter System: Worm-gear case equipped with a 300mm x 40mm filter. Features 7.2kw heating power for smooth processing.
4. Roller Cooling: Spiral cooling method (not linear) is used inside each drum via trough irons to ensure highly effective temperature control.
5. Winding Station: Double working station design allows for continuous operation; while one roller is full, the other takes over to save time.
6. Scrap Recycling: Includes a dedicated scrap rewinder to efficiently collect edge materials for recycling.
